# DevSync
DevSync is a powerful tool designed for developers to effortlessly compare and synchronize coding projects. Whether you're working across multiple environments, collaborating with a team, or simply managing different versions of your codebase, DevSync helps ensure consistency by identifying and fixing discrepancies.

With DevSync, you can:

- **Compare Folders:** Analyze two coding project folders to identify missing files or differences in file content.
- **Fix Discrepancies:** Automatically resolve issues by restoring missing files and synchronizing content across projects.
- **Detailed Reporting:** Get comprehensive reports on the differences found and the actions taken to fix them.
- **Simple and Efficient:** Streamline your development process, reduce errors, and ensure that your projects are always in sync.

## Functionality

DevSync will:

1. **Traverse Folders and Sub-Folders:** Go through all the folders and sub-folders to ensure comprehensive comparison.
2. **Read Files:** Examine the content of each file to identify discrepancies.
3. **Generate Output:** Provide a detailed report indicating which folders, files, sub-folders, or file contents are missing.

**Decision Point:**

After generating the report, you can decide whether to:

- **Add Missing Elements:** Incorporate the missing folders, files, or content into your project.
- **Skip Additions:** Choose not to add the missing elements based on your specific needs.

The decision to update your folder with the missing elements is entirely up to you.

**Running the Project**
======================

To run the project, follow these steps:

### Step 1: Clone the Repository
Clone the repository using the following command:
```bash
git clone https://github.com/codeterrayt/DevSync.git && cd DevSync
```

### Step 2: Run the Main Script
Run the main script using Python:
```python
python main.py
```
That's it!
